Konecranes has selected Cavotec to supply advanced cable reel technologies for two electrically powered Boxhunter Rubber Tyred Gantry (RTG) cranes at an application in Paraguay. The cranes are the latest generation of Konecranes lightweight RTG cranes, and are set to reduce environmental impact and improve operational efficiency at the port.
Working closely with mining group Atlas Copco, Cavotec has developed an innovative Human Operator Interface (HOI) system, incorporating long-range wireless communication, for operators of rugged loader vehicles used in mining applications deep underground. The solution, which first entered service in 2016, has generated substantial safety and efficiency gains at a mining application in Russia.

We’re proud to support heavy-duty haulage specialist Goldhofer to move some of the world’s heaviest objects. Over the past 10 years, Cavotec Radio Remote Control (RRC) solutions have helped transport NASA’s Space Shuttle Endeavour, shift a vast bridge section on the French island of La Reunion, and carry segments of oil rigs, building structures, and large tanks and reservoirs.
